"As a Man Series" Track 1, Police vs. Dr. Umar Johnson, & Donald Trump Calls for Christian Vote

1. Recap of the ‘As a Man’ Series: Izzy kicks off with an insightful recap of the first track, “As a Man, Why Are You Impatient?” He explores how the episode seamlessly blends humor with faith-based discussions, relatable stories, and solid statistics to offer a comprehensive look at the roots and impacts of impatience
2. Dr. Umar Johnson Incident: We delve into a recent incident involving Dr. Umar Johnson, a known advocate for being very vocal about everything black , who was questioned by police at an airport—a situation suspected to be racially motivated. Izzy breaks down how Dr. Umar’s composed response potentially avoided reinforcing stereotypes and what this means for mental health and racial perceptions.
3. Donald Trump’s Political Maneuvers: The conversation gets heated as Izzy discusses Donald Trump’s latest claims and actions. Is Trump merely an actor playing a polarizing role? This segment explores the psychological and societal implications of Trump’s tactics and their influence on public behavior and mental health.
🧠 What Does This Have to Do With Mental Health?
Each segment of our discussion today connects back to mental health, from understanding our triggers and responses to recognizing how societal figures influence our mental states and actions. These conversations are vital for cultivating resilience and self-awareness in a world that constantly tests our mental and emotional limits.
